Broadcom: Q1 EPS up 26%

(CercleFinance.com) - On Thursday evening Broadcom unveiled an adjusted EPS (non-GAAP) of 6.
61 dollars for Q1 2020-21, up nearly 26% year-on-year and slightly above the consensus.

Also in adjusted data, the California-based supplier of semiconductor products improved its EBITDA by nearly 21% to 3.94 billion dollars, for sales that are up 14% to 6.65 billion dollars.

For the current quarter, Broadcom expects adjusted EBITDA to be approximately 59% of estimated revenues of approximately 6.5 billion dollars, with the forecast being only an estimate of what the company believes is achievable at this time.
